Patriots Mural by anonymous person

Patriots muralThis is going to make Patriots Fans really angry. particularly Mary Snow, of Cohasset. We don’t know that the Patriots cheated. But it was fun to walk through Cohasset Village this week and hear fans attempt to explain what happened, or didn’t happen. Nobody wanted to be quoted.

Science explanation

We think this happened. They filled the balls up inside and when they took them outside it was colder and the same thing that happens to my tires in the winter (I need more air) happened to the balls. In any case, that’s my story and I’m sticking to it.




